AIX Useful Commands - BLV/Kernel Processes PDF Print E-mail
Written by Peter   
aix.jpgMirroring does not work with the BLV as it is not a true logical volume, bosboot must be run against the other disk after mirroring the rootvg.

bootlist -m (normal or service) -o                       displays bootlist

bootlist -m (normal or service) (list of devices)        change bootlist


ipl_varyon -i    lists all available boot devices

bootinfo -b                  Identifies the bootable disk

bootinfo -t                  Specifies type of boot

bosboot -a -d (/dev/pv)      Creates a complete boot image on a physical volume.

mkboot -c -d (/dev/pv)       Zero's out the boot records on the physical volume.

savebase -d (/dev/pv)        Saves customised ODM info onto the boot device.

lslv -m hd5                  Find out which disk the BLV is on.

bootinfo -y                  Displays which kernel can be used, 32 or 64 bit

genkex                       Reports all loaded kernel extensions.

lsdev -Cc processor          Lists all processors

lsattr -EHl proc0            Displays attributes of processor 0. AIX 5.1L will display processor clock frequency.
